Homemade Beef Enchiladas

Comforting homemade Beef Enchiladas filled with ground beef, cheese, and zesty enchilada sauce, perfect for family dinners.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 cup chopped onion
  • 1 can (15 oz) enchilada sauce
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or Mexican blend)
  • 8 small flour tortillas
  • 1 can (15 oz) black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 cup corn (frozen or canned)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Chopped cilantro for garnish (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Sauté the ground beef and onion in a skillet over medium heat until browned. Drain excess fat.
  3. Combine black beans, corn, and half of the enchilada sauce. Season with salt and pepper, then remove from heat.
  4. Fill each tortilla with a portion of the beef mixture, sprinkle with cheese, roll up, and place seam-side down in a baking dish.
  5. Pour the remaining enchilada sauce over the tortillas and sprinkle with remaining cheese.
  6.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
  7. Garnish with chopped cilantro if desired and serve hot.

Notes

For added flavor, consider mixing different cheeses or adding diced jalapeños. Make ahead by preparing the filling a day in advance.
